What Is a Payday Loan?
A payday loan is a small, short-term loan that helps individuals manage urgent expenses before their next salary is credited. The payday loan’s meaning is closely tied to its repayment structure; borrowers are expected to repay the loan in full, along with applicable charges, on their next payday or within a short tenure.
Unlike traditional loans, payday loans focus more on quick access rather than long-term affordability. They are often used for immediate financial needs rather than planned expenses.
How Payday Loans Work
The process of taking a payday loan is typically simple and fast:
- You apply through a lender or a payday loan online platform
- Basic details such as income, employment, and identity are verified
- Once approved, funds are disbursed quickly, sometimes within hours
- The loan is repaid in a single payment or over a very short tenure
With digital platforms offering instant online payday loan services, the entire process, from application to disbursal, can happen without visiting a physical branch.
Key Features of Payday Loans
Before choosing a payday loan, it helps to know what makes them different. These features explain why they are often used for short-term financial needs.
Quick approval and fast disbursal
One of the biggest reasons people opt for payday loans is how fast they are processed. In many cases, the approval and fund transfer happen within a short time.
Minimal documentation requirements
Compared to traditional loans, documentation is limited. Basic KYC and income proof are usually sufficient.
Short repayment tenure
These loans are typically repaid within a few weeks or by the next salary cycle. This makes them different from standard personal loans, which have longer tenures.
Higher interest rates compared to standard loans
One of the defining features is the cost. Payday loans generally have higher interest rates or fees due to their short-term nature and quick processing.

Things to Consider Before Taking a Payday Loan
A payday loan can feel like a quick fix, but it helps to pause and look at a few key things before applying. This can save you from surprises later and help you choose a better option if needed.
Check the total cost
Do not look at just the loan amount. Always check the full cost, including interest and any extra charges. For example, even a small loan for a short period can turn out to be expensive if the fees are high.
Look at the lender carefully
Not all lenders follow the same practices. Go with a platform that clearly shows terms, charges, and repayment details upfront. This helps you avoid confusion later.
Plan your repayment in advance
Since these loans are repaid quickly, make sure your upcoming salary can cover it. If you already have other expenses lined up, repayment can become difficult.

Is a payday loan the same as a personal loan?
No. Payday loans are short-term with higher costs, while personal loans usually have longer tenures, structured EMIs, and comparatively lower interest rates.
